Take Easier: Boosting Your Home Air Cleanliness
The typical person spends a large portion of their time indoors, making the air vital to wellness to ensure clean air. Sadly, indoor air can often be more polluted than outdoor air, due to elements like allergens, chemicals from household products, and including animal dander. Luckily, there are practical steps you can do to enhance your indoor air quality. Consider investing in an breathing purifier with a advanced filter, regularly ventilating your space by opening windows, and choosing natural coatings and housekeeping products. Besides, ensure proper airflow in eating zones and lavatories to remove dampness and minimize the risk of mildew growth.

Boosting Indoor Air: For Greater Health and Keener Focus
The quality of the air we breathe indoors often gets dismissed, yet it plays a essential role in our overall well-being and cognitive function. From usual allergens like dust and pet fur to harmful volatile organic compounds chemicals released from carpets, the indoor environment can present a surprising number of problems. Focusing on indoor air quality isn’t just about experiencing better; it's about fostering peak health, minimizing allergy effects, and increasing your ability to concentrate and achieve at your best. Simple steps, like regular ventilation, the use of air cleaners, and selecting low-VOC-producing items, can make a significant impact in how you feel and operate every day. Finally, investing in your indoor air is an investment in your health.
